Transaction 58c57435ada38e723fe68c3c6890b1876bb2cafb4ffa24b7e72f2adc9d62dc5a

1 Input
2 Outputs
  • 58c57435ada38e723fe68c3c6890b1876bb2cafb4ffa24b7e72f2adc9d62dc5a:0
  • value  46774
    address  3MMWy12o5ddfyiMumE2rp4HY5bPB6EaDsx
  • 58c57435ada38e723fe68c3c6890b1876bb2cafb4ffa24b7e72f2adc9d62dc5a:1
  • value  7442788
    address  bc1qe9gce37x03drngwem2xyemn5kq3zz8hvt0uqvn